One thousand kilograms per hour of a mixture of benzene and toluene that contains 50% by mass are seperated by distallation into two fractions.

The mass flow of benzene in the top stream is 450kg benzne/hour, and toluene in the bottom stream is 475 kg toulene/hour.

Write the material balance on benzene and toluene to calculate the unknown components in the output stream.

Answer:

50 kg benzene/hour and 25 kg toluene/hour

Step-by-step explanation:

According to Lavoisier's law, the mass can't be created either destroyed, thus, the material in the input must be equal to the material in the output + the material formed if there's a reaction + the accumulation in the reactor.

Thus, for bezene:

minput = mtop + mbottom

If 50% of the mass is composed by each substance:

0.5*1000 = 450 + mbottom

500 = 450 + mbottom

mbottom = 50 kg benzene/hour

For toluene:

minput = mtop + mbottom

0.5*1000 = mtop + 475

mtop = 500 -475

mtop = 25 kg toluene/hour
